From: Yang Guang > Sent: 05 November 2021 06:19 > > Use the macro 'swap()' defined in 'include/linux/minmax.h' to avoid > opencoding it.
Is there any real point to any of these patches??
If I'm reading a 'random' piece of code I now have to assume that swap() is something that 'magically' exchanges two items. This requires more brain-power than parsing the three lines that do an actual swap.
